> Subject: [PATCH] common/cpt: add support for new firmware
> 
> From: Ankur Dwivedi <adwivedi@marvell.com>
> 
> With the latest firmware, there are few changes for zuc and snow3g.
> 
> 1. The iv_source is present in bitfield 7 of minor opcode. In the old firmware this
> was present in bitfield 6.
> 
> 2. Algorithm type is a 2 bit field in new firmware. In the old firmware it was
> named as cipher type and it was a 1 bit field.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Ankur Dwivedi <adwivedi@marvell.com>
> Signed-off-by: Anoob Joseph <anoobj@marvell.com>
> ---
>  drivers/common/cpt/cpt_mcode_defines.h | 4 ++--
>  drivers/common/cpt/cpt_ucode.h         | 6 ++++--
>  2 files changed, 6 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_mcode_defines.h
> b/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_mcode_defines.h
> index c0adbd5..b7c3feb 100644
> --- a/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_mcode_defines.h
> +++ b/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_mcode_defines.h
> @@ -303,8 +303,8 @@ struct cpt_ctx {
>  	uint64_t hmac		:1;
>  	uint64_t zsk_flags	:3;
>  	uint64_t k_ecb		:1;
> -	uint64_t snow3g		:1;
> -	uint64_t rsvd		:22;
> +	uint64_t snow3g		:2;
> +	uint64_t rsvd		:21;
>  	/* Below fields are accessed by hardware */
>  	union {
>  		mc_fc_context_t fctx;
> diff --git a/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_ucode.h
> b/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_ucode.h index 7d9c31e..0dac12e 100644
> --- a/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_ucode.h
> +++ b/drivers/common/cpt/cpt_ucode.h
> @@ -1467,7 +1467,8 @@ cpt_zuc_snow3g_enc_prep(uint32_t req_flags,
>  	opcode.s.major = CPT_MAJOR_OP_ZUC_SNOW3G;
> 
>  	/* indicates CPTR ctx, operation type, KEY & IV mode from DPTR */
> -	opcode.s.minor = ((1 << 6) | (snow3g << 5) | (0 << 4) |
> +
> +	opcode.s.minor = ((1 << 7) | (snow3g << 5) | (0 << 4) |
>  			  (0 << 3) | (flags & 0x7));
> 
>  	if (flags == 0x1) {
> @@ -1791,7 +1792,8 @@ cpt_zuc_snow3g_dec_prep(uint32_t req_flags,
>  	opcode.s.major = CPT_MAJOR_OP_ZUC_SNOW3G;
> 
>  	/* indicates CPTR ctx, operation type, KEY & IV mode from DPTR */
> -	opcode.s.minor = ((1 << 6) | (snow3g << 5) | (0 << 4) |
> +
> +	opcode.s.minor = ((1 << 7) | (snow3g << 5) | (0 << 4) |
>  			  (0 << 3) | (flags & 0x7));
> 
>  	/* consider iv len */
> --
> 2.7.4
